The technical hurdles explain why such a patch remains unverified. The PSP version of Jo (released in 2010) uses a proprietary script compression system common to many visual novels of the era. Extracting and re-inserting Japanese text without breaking the game’s delicate event flags is a herculean task. Moreover, the game’s assets—sprites, background art, and lip-sync data—are tied directly to the original text’s character count. English requires more space, leading to text overflow or font corruption. A truly verified patch would require not just translators, but reverse engineers, assembly coders, and graphic artists to redraw UI elements.
